Madhya Pradesh Signs ₹7,430 Crore Kuwait Fisheries Investment Deal to Boost Exports, Jobs and Aquaculture Growth

Under the Integrated Fisheries Industry Policy 2026, the agreement aims to develop major reservoirs, increase fish production by 4 lakh tonnes, generate 35,000 jobs, and position the state as a global fisheries export hub.

Bhopal: In a major boost to Madhya Pradesh’s fisheries and aquaculture sector, the state government has signed a landmark investment agreement worth ₹7,430 crore with a leading Kuwait-based fisheries company. The agreement, formalized in the presence of Chief Minister Dr. Mohan Yadav, is expected to significantly enhance fish production, exports, and rural employment in the state.

Major International Investment Under Integrated Fisheries Policy 2026

The agreement has been signed under the Madhya Pradesh Integrated Fisheries Industry Policy 2026, aimed at attracting global investment and modernizing the state’s fisheries ecosystem.

The deal involves Kuwait’s leading fisheries company, Zabedi Al Kuwait Fisheries Company, and Kamdar’s Care, Indore, a cluster-based business organization supporting farmer producer groups and agri-business development.

Officials stated that this partnership marks a new chapter in international collaboration for Madhya Pradesh’s fisheries sector.

Infrastructure Development in Major Reservoirs

As part of the agreement, large-scale infrastructure development will be undertaken across key water bodies in the state, including:

  • Indira Sagar Reservoir
  • Bargi Reservoir
  • Bansagar Reservoir
  • Barna Reservoir

The project will focus on developing cage culture systems, along with backward and forward linkage infrastructure to support large-scale fish production and supply chain efficiency.

Massive Increase in Fish and Vegetable Production

The initiative is expected to significantly boost agricultural and allied production in the state:

  • Approximately 4 lakh tonnes of additional fish production through cage culture
  • Around 1.23 lakh tonnes of vegetables using aquaponics, hydroponics, and greenhouse farming systems

This integrated model aims to promote sustainable and modern farming practices alongside fisheries development.

Export Target of ₹6,000 Crore from Fisheries Sector

The Madhya Pradesh government has set an ambitious export target of approximately ₹6,000 crore in fisheries exports under this initiative.

The partnership is expected to strengthen the state’s position in international seafood markets while improving value-added processing and export infrastructure.

Employment Generation for 35,000 People

The project is projected to generate large-scale employment opportunities across the state:

  • 15,000 direct jobs
  • 20,000 indirect jobs
  • Total: Around 35,000 employment opportunities

The government has emphasized that the initiative will directly benefit fishing communities and rural populations dependent on aquaculture-based livelihoods.

Strengthening Rural Economy and Fishermen Welfare

Chief Minister Dr. Mohan Yadav stated that the state government is committed to enhancing farmer and fisher welfare through diversified income sources such as animal husbandry and fisheries.

He highlighted that Madhya Pradesh has vast water resources and reservoirs, which present immense potential for fisheries development and food security enhancement.

Madhya Pradesh Emerging as Fisheries Investment Hub

The agreement is expected to position Madhya Pradesh as a leading hub for fisheries investment and exports in India. The Kuwait-based company reportedly operates in over 10 countries with a strong presence in premium food products, canned goods, and spices.

Kamdar’s Care, Indore, is known for supporting farmer producer organizations (FPOs) and promoting agribusiness expansion, with recognition under Startup India initiatives.

High-Level Presence During Agreement Signing

The signing ceremony took place at the Chief Minister’s residence in Bhopal (Samatva Bhavan), attended by senior officials and dignitaries, including:

  • Minister of Fisheries Development (Independent Charge)
  • State legislators
  • Senior bureaucrats from the Chief Minister’s Office
  • Representatives from Kuwait’s agriculture and fisheries authorities
  • Investment advisors and industry experts

The ₹7,430 crore international fisheries investment marks a transformative step for Madhya Pradesh’s blue economy. With large-scale infrastructure development, increased production targets, export expansion, and significant job creation, the initiative is set to reshape the state’s fisheries landscape and strengthen its global competitiveness.
